Cerritos College Opens State’s First Housing Development for Students Facing Homelessness

Cerritos College marked the grand opening Thursday of California’s first community college housing development exclusively for students facing homelessness.

The seven townhouses are located a few blocks away from the campus and offer both free and discounted rental options, the college announced in a press release. The development, called The Village, will house students between 18 to 25 years old.
